2014 Jeep Grand Cherokee — MOT failures & pass rate
The 2014 Jeep Grand Cherokee passed 84.1% of its 8,603 recorded MOT tests. That is effectively the same as large SUVs of a similar age (15.0% fail rate), so the MOT record here is unremarkable in either direction. Failures cluster in brakes, lighting & signalling and tyres.
What the MOT record shows
No single area dominates — brakes (6.9%) and lighting & signalling (5.2%) are close, so failures are spread across several systems rather than one weak point.
At component level the recurring items are tread depth, brake pads and rbt (sp) — tread depth alone was recorded 253 times.
Condition tracks the odometer closely. Failures run at 7.4% in the 0-30k band and 19.6% in the 150k+ band, a 12.3-point spread — more than double.
Brakes is the most common advisory, noted on 21.4% of tests — work that passed today but is likely due soon.
The trend is worsening — 15.4% of tests failed in 2021 against 18.8% in 2025, the usual pattern as a fleet ages.

What to check before buying a 2014 Grand Cherokee
The failure pattern for this year is specific enough to inspect against: brakes accounted for 6.9% of tests. Start there.
- Brakes (6.9% of tests): Pads/discs are routine wear; binding, imbalance or corroded pipes are more serious — test for pulling under braking. Typical repair: £100–£350 per axle.
- Lighting & signalling (5.2% of tests): Often a cheap bulb, but persistent issues can mean wiring or corrosion in the units. Typical repair: £10–£150.
- Tyres (4.3% of tests): Usually a quick, known-cost fix, but check tread, age and uneven wear (which can hint at alignment or suspension issues). Typical repair: £50–£120 per tyre.
Repair costs are rough UK ballpark ranges to set expectations, not quotes — actual prices vary widely by car, parts and garage.
